http://pressbooks-dev.oer.hawaii.edu/anatomyandphysiology/chapter/protein-synthesis/ WebbProtein Biosynthesis – Translation The process by which the mRNA codes for a particular protein is known as Translation. In the process, the ribosome translates the mRNA produced from DNA into a chain of specific amino acids. This chain of amino acids leads to protein synthesis.

Protein biosynthesis (or protein synthesis) is a core biological process, occurring inside cells, balancing the loss of cellular proteins (via degradation or export) through the production of new proteins.
